为了账号安全,请及时绑定邮箱和手机立即绑定

key 和 value 是一样的吗?

for key in d: 和 for value in d: 的输出结果是一致的,为什么?

正在回答

3 回答

for xx in d:

## 这这个语句中, xx 可以为任何 正确的变量名(3点)
## 1. 只包含字母,数字,下划线(_)
## 2. 不能以数字开头
## 3. 尽量不要用Python 保留字 如(sum, del, len) 等等

## 最后说明,这个变量名 并不影响 for xx in dict , 每次循环 只取 字典 key 的原理。


1 回复 有任何疑惑可以回复我~

这里的key与value 只是你随便指定的一种变量名,可以是x,y,z……

0 回复 有任何疑惑可以回复我~

因为 key和value只是一种变量名,假设后面是一种List

print 就会输出List中的元素

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
初识Python
  • 参与学习       758623    人
  • 解答问题       8667    个

学python入门视频教程,让你快速入门并能编写简单的Python程序

进入课程

key 和 value 是一样的吗?

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信